About the Role

We are seeking an experienced Infrastructure Specialist / System Administrator to support the delivery of a large-scale technology uplift program for an enterprise client. This role will suit an infrastructure “all-rounder” with broad technical capability across cloud, network, backup and storage environments.

Working under the guidance of the Infrastructure Architect, you will play a key role in the assessment, configuration and implementation of new infrastructure capabilities. The position will involve hands-on technical delivery, documentation, and support of change and governance activities.

Key Responsibilities

  • Support the design, build and configuration of a new cloud environment in line with architectural direction
  • Assess and implement backup and storage solutions to meet enterprise resilience and recovery requirements
  • Assist with configuration and optimisation of Cisco network infrastructure
  • Perform system administration across core platforms and services
  • Contribute to Environment Design Plans (EDP) and technical documentation
  • Support change management processes, including preparation of change requests and implementation plans
  • Troubleshoot infrastructure issues and provide technical resolution
  • Work closely with the Infrastructure Architect, security, and project teams to ensure alignment with standards
  • Participate in testing, cutover and post-implementation support activities
